One-step extraction and separation of high purity chitin based on choline ionic liquid
In view of the shortcomings of traditional chitosan preparation process such as high pollution and high water consumption,this paper proposes a new green method for preparing high-purity chitosan based on ionic liquids.The results showed that the[Emim]OAc and[Ch]Ms can respectively prepare chitin with purities of 90.7%and 97.4%,and yields of 38.1%and 63.9%through a two-step dissolution-regeneration method and a one-step dissolution-separation method.Compared with the 1-ethyl-3-methylimidazolium acetate([Emim]OAc)extraction system,the water content has less influence on chitin extraction by choline methanesulfonate[Ch]Ms.When the water content increases to 50%,the chitin purity still reached 94.3%,and the yield remained at 60%.Additionally,the chitin structure obtained from the[Ch]Ms separation remained in the α form,while the chitin obtained from the[Emim]OAc separation transitioned to a semi-α form.The preliminary mechanism indicated that the synergistic action of the cations and anions in[Ch]Ms effectively removed protein and calcium carbonate,resulting in high-purity chitin.Compared to the[Emim]OAc system,the[Ch]Ms system offered advantages such as lower cost,easier separation,and shorter processing time,making it more suitable for large-scale applications.
